ROSS v. La COSTE de MONTERVILLE

No. 86-C-0538.

502 So.2d 1026 (1987)

Dean Ross, Wife of/and John K. ROSS v. Daniel LA COSTE de MONTERVILLE, Erick Houeland, State Farm Insurance Company and Harry's Ace Hardware Store.

Supreme Court of Louisiana.

Rehearing Denied March 25, 1987.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Kenny Charbonnet, for applicant.

Joseph Ward, Ward & Clesi, Owen Neff, Peter Title, Sessions, Fishman, et al., for respondent.


DENNIS, Justice.

The issue in this case is whether the owner of a thing containing structural defects who gratuitously lends it to a borrower continues to have the garde or custody of the thing's structure and therefore may be held strictly liable for the borrower's injuries caused by its defects.
